A quadruple-word, often referred to as a quadword, is a data type commonly used in computer architecture and programming. It consists of four words, where each word is typically a 16-bit unit, resulting in a total of 64 bits. This format is crucial in environments that require high precision and large data handling, such as graphics processing and scientific computations. The use of quadruple-words allows for efficient data manipulation and storage, providing a balance between performance and memory usage. Understanding quadruple-words is essential for developers working with complex data-intensive applications.
Definition of KilobyteA kilobyte (KB) is a unit of digital information storage that equals 1,024 bytes, as per the binary system commonly used in computing. It is a fundamental unit for measuring data size, often used to describe file sizes or storage capacity. The kilobyte serves as a stepping stone to larger units like megabytes and gigabytes, facilitating the organization and management of digital information. In everyday tech usage, understanding kilobytes is crucial for assessing storage needs, optimizing system performance, and managing data efficiently. This unit remains integral to both hardware and software contexts.
